A SMALL BLACK-GLAZED BOTTLE VASE JIN DYNASTY

the pear-shaped body rising from a recessed base to a slender neck with an everted rim, covered overall with a lustrous black glaze, save for the foot ring left unglazed to reveal the buff-colored stoneware body

Condition

In overall good condition, except for two very minor shallow chips to the underside of the rim, the larger measuring approx. 0.4 cm wide. Some minor surface wear and expected firing imperfections.
